Title: Wallace J Lannen: Innovator in Optical Fiber Alignment Technology
Introduction
Wallace J Lannen is a notable inventor based in Ft. Collins, CO (US). He has made significant contributions to the field of optical technology, particularly in the alignment of optical fibers with waveguides. With a total of 3 patents, Lannen's work has advanced the precision and efficiency of optical systems.
Latest Patents
One of Lannen's latest patents is a method, apparatus, and system for aligning an optical fiber end with an optical waveguide. This innovative alignment system utilizes a single optical sensor to facilitate the precise alignment of an optical fiber's end with the input of an optical waveguide in an optical device. The system processes the output of the optical sensor, converting it into digital signals that are further refined through an alignment algorithm. This process generates feedback signals that enable accurate alignment. The system comprises a single optical sensor, a lens, and sophisticated processing logic, including an electrical processing circuit that produces an amplified, filtered signal with low noise and a wide dynamic range. An analog-to-digital converter (ADC) is employed to convert the processed output into digital signals, which are then analyzed by a computer executing the alignment algorithm. The feedback signals generated are sent to a motion control system, which adjusts the spatial positioning of the optical fiber end based on the feedback received.
